Table of Contents Derivatives are instruments to handle monetary risks. Given that risk is an intrinsic part of any investment, monetary markets developed derivatives as their own version of managing financial danger. Derivatives are structured as contracts and derive their returns from other monetary instruments. If the marketplace consisted of just basic financial investments like stocks and bonds, managing danger would be as easy as altering the portfolio allotment amongst dangerous stocks and risk-free bonds.
Derivatives are one of the ways to guarantee your investments against market fluctuations. A derivative is specified as a financial instrument created to earn a market return based upon the returns of another underlying asset. It is aptly named after its mechanism; as its reward is originated from some other financial instrument.
It might be as easy as one celebration paying some cash to the other https://www.timeshareexitcompanies.com/wesley-financial-group-reviews/ and in return, receiving protection versus future financial losses. There likewise could be a scenario where no cash payment is involved in advance. In such cases, both the parties concur to do something for each other at a later date.
Every derivative commences on a specific date and ends on a later date. Generally, the payoff from a particular derivative contract is calculated and/or is made on the termination date, although this can vary in many cases. As specified in the definition, the performance of a derivative is dependent on the hidden possession's performance.
This property is sold a market where both the buyers and the sellers equally decide its cost, and after that the seller provides the underlying to the purchaser and is paid in return. Area or money rate is the price of the underlying if purchased immediately. Derivative contracts can be differentiated into several types.
These contracts have basic features and terms, without any personalization enabled and are backed by a clearinghouse. Over the counter (OTC) contracts are those transactions that are produced by both purchasers and sellers anywhere else. Such agreements are uncontrolled and might bring the default risk for the contract owner. Usually, the derivatives are categorized into 2 broad classifications: Forward Commitments Contingent Claims Forward commitments are agreements in which the celebrations assure to execute the deal at a particular later date at a price agreed upon in the beginning.

The underlying can either be a physical asset or a stock. The loss or gain of a specific party is determined by the price motion of the possession. If the rate boosts, the purchaser sustains a gain as he still gets to buy the asset at the older and lower cost.
For a comprehensive understanding, you can read our exclusive post on Swap can be specified as a series of forward derivatives. It is essentially an agreement between 2 parties where they exchange a series of cash flows in the future. One party will consent to pay the drifting rate of interest on a primary quantity while the other party will pay a fixed rates of interest on the very same quantity in return.
Exchange traded forward commitments are called futures. A future agreement is another version of a forward agreement, which is exchange-traded and standardized. Unlike forward contracts, future contracts are actively traded in the secondary market, have the support of the clearinghouse, follow policies and involve a daily settlement cycle of gains and losses. There are even derivatives based upon other derivatives. The reason for this is that derivatives are very good at satisfying the requirements of several services and people worldwide. Futures agreements: This is a contract made in between 2 parties (a buyer and seller) that a product or monetary instrument will be purchased or cost an established price on a predetermined future date.
These agreements are commonly readily available for dozens of stock market indices and practically every commodity that is commercially produced consisting of commercial and rare-earth elements, seeds, grains, livestock, oil and gas and even carbon credits. Forward agreements: These are extremely comparable to futures agreements however with some essential distinctions. A forward contract is tailor-made in between two parties and is a contract to purchase or offer an asset or product at a given rate on an offered date (what is considered a derivative work finance).
Alternative contracts: An option agreement provides the agreement owner (the buyer) the right to purchase or offer a pre-determined amount of a hidden possession. The secret here is that the owner deserves to buy, not the obligation. They have grown rapidly in popularity recently and choices exist for a large range of underlying assets.
With a call alternative, the owner deserves to buy the hidden possession. With a put alternative, the owner deserves to sell it. Swaps: While not technically derivatives, swaps are usually considered as such. A swap is a contract whereby 2 parties literally exchange, or swap, a financial instrument's capital for a minimal duration of time.

Unlike futures and choices agreements, swaps are traded over-the-counter in between the celebrations involved and the swaps market is controlled by banks and corporations with couple of personal individuals taking part. Credit derivatives: This refers to one of many monetary instruments and strategies utilized to separate and transfer credit risk. The threat in concern is typically that of a default by corporate or personal borrowers.
Although there are lots of type of credit derivative, they can be broadly divided into two categories: funded credit derivatives and unfunded credit derivatives. An unfunded credit derivative is a bilateral agreement in between 2 celebrations and each celebration is accountable for finishing its payments. A financed credit derivative is where the defense seller (the party who is presuming the credit danger) makes a payment that is later utilized to settle any credit events that might happen.
When it comes to a negative difference happening, the seller is paid by the buyer. Hedging or mitigating threat. This is typically done to guarantee or safeguard against the danger of an underlying possession. For instance, those wishing to secure themselves in the occasion of their stock's price toppling might purchase a put option.
To offer leverage. A small movement in the rate of an underlying property can create a big distinction in a derivative's worth. Options agreements in specific are especially valuable in an unstable marketplace. When the hidden possession's price relocations significantly in a more beneficial direction then the alternative's value is magnified.
This is a strategy where investors actually speculate on an asset's future rate. This is tied in with take advantage of due to the fact that when investors are able to use leverage on their position (as an outcome of options contracts), they are likewise able to make large speculative plays at a reasonably low cost.
Although they can permit investors to make large amounts of money from small price motions in the underlying property, there is also the possibility that big losses could be made if the price relocations considerably in the other instructions. what are derivative instruments in finance. There have actually been some high-profile examples of this in the previous involving AIG, Barings Bank, Socit Gnrale and others.

This is threat that occurs from the other party in monetary transactions. Different derivatives have different levels of counterparty risk and some of the standardised variations are required by law to have actually a quantity deposited with the exchange in order to pay for any losses. Big notional worth. Famed American investor Warren Buffett once explained derivatives as 'financial weapons of mass destruction' since of the risk that their use might produce huge losses for which financiers would be unable to compensate.
Derivatives have actually also been criticised for their intricacy. The various acquired techniques are so complicated that they can only be executed by experts making them a hard tool for layperson to make use of. More precisely, what makes derivatives unique is that they derive their worth from something called an "underlying." The term "underlying" ended up being a sort of shorthand to explain the types of financial possessions that offered the financial value upon which monetary derivatives are based. These underlying financial possessions can take many forms: everything from stocks, bonds, and commodities to things as abstract as rate of interest, market indexes, and international currencies - finance what is a derivative.
This, in a sense, is what makes them so controversial and, as we discovered from the financial crisis of 2008, so unstable. While the functions of trading derivatives are numerous and inherently complex, there are some basic ideas at play in a lot of circumstances of derivative trading. The primary reason financier sell derivatives is to hedge their bets versus numerous economic and monetary risks.
The dangers that these financiers are trying https://www.inhersight.com/companies/best/reviews/responsiveness?_n=112289636 to avoid by employing these smart financial instruments consist of things like rates of interest shifts, currency values, and credit ratings. Through complicated financial mechanisms, derivatives are frequently utilized to take advantage of possessions. This suggests that even slight shifts in the value of the underlying possession can potentially lead to massive changes in value for the derivative.
